Not sure what you mean by answer.

2L +2W =P is a formula for the perimeter of a rectangle

2L=P-2W

L=(P-2W)/2 puts the length on a side by itself.

If you were given a perimeter =40 and the width=7, the

L =(40-2(7) / 2 =26/2=13 is the length
